Humanitarian crisis in the heart of town

Following a damning report from the city ombudsman, La Presse has a photo essay on what it’s calling the faces of a humanitarian crisis – the homeless Indigenous people who have been clustering around Park Avenue and Milton since the Open Door shelter moved to the area.
